Constructing a Network Diagram Are there any pre-requisites for this topic? NO. You may have come across terms like  critical path  but no knowledge is pre-supposed.
Constructing a Network Diagram Project management is also referred to as: network analysis critical path analysis PERT   - program evaluation & review technique
Constructing a Network Diagram OK, so whats a project? Well any managerial activity can be represented as a project. For example: developing a new product or service marketing a new product or service breaking into a new market building a new plant installing a new computer system planning a training programme re-locating head office.
Constructing a Network Diagram What do your example projects have in common? Each can be decomposed into its constituent parts, called  ACTIVITIES . We can then define a project as a collection of related activities. Three things are important: each activity takes time each activity uses up resources activities are structured.
Constructing a Network Diagram What gives activities structure? But thats too vague. A roof cannot be erected unless the foundations have been dug. Obviously true! So digging foundations must precede erecting the roof! But what about the walls? So we refer to the   immediately preceding activities . Precedence : some activities have to be completed before others can be started.
Constructing a Network Diagram The first step for any project is to: list the constituent activities arrange them into a  Precedence Table . Constructing a Network Diagram Precedence tables arent that easy to use. Is there some other way of representing a project? Y E S A useful visual representation of a project is obtained by drawing a network diagram.

Constructing a Network Diagram Are there any rules to follow when drawing network diagrams? YES Must be drawn from left to right. 2.  Must have a single starting point. 3.  Also a single ending point.  4.  One arrow (only) per activity. 5.  Must correctly reflect the precedence table.
Constructing a Network Diagram There is one complication that we need to allow for. A dummy activity may be needed: to prevent 2 or more activities sharing the same starting  and  ending events. to maintain network logic  i.e. to ensure that the network abides by the precedence table. OK, tell me the worst!! Sometimes we have to use  Dummy  activities. We use a dashed arrow to record these.
